Elevate Health Pros and Cons
What We Like
- +Oral semaglutide from $114/mo — one of the lowest prices for any form of semaglutide in the market
- +Free blood work included with all GLP-1 programs for baseline health assessment and monitoring
- +Buy-now-pay-later financing via Affirm, Klarna, and Afterpay — removes the upfront cost barrier
- +Medications sourced from FDA-registered 503B outsourcing facilities — stricter oversight than standard compounding
What Could Be Better
- −Promo-dependent pricing — standard tirzepatide is $449/mo without discount, nearly double the promo price
- −Select state availability only — not available nationwide
- −Trustpilot rating flagged for potential review solicitation — verify independently

All pricing tiers
Oral Semaglutide (promo)
$114/moPromotional pricing for oral compounded semaglutide — one of the lowest prices available
Injectable Semaglutide
$233/moStandard injectable semaglutide program with free blood work and unlimited visits
Compounded GLP/GIP (tirzepatide)
$249/moCompounded tirzepatide in alternative format; promo from $249, standard ~$449/mo
Zepbound (Brand, added 2026)
$349/moFDA-approved Zepbound tirzepatide injection — new 2026 brand-name offering
Cancellation policy: Cancel anytime — takes effect at end of billing cycle, no prorated refunds
How Elevate Health works
Complete Online Assessment
Fill out a health assessment covering your medical history, medications, and weight loss goals.
Telehealth Visit & Free Blood Work
A licensed clinician reviews your information via telehealth. Free blood work is included to establish your health baseline.
Medication Ships with Financing Options
If approved, medication ships to your door. Pay upfront or use Affirm, Klarna, or Afterpay for installment payments.
